Jamie works with the Canal Alliance English as a Second Language (ESL) Program and assists with job training and economic development efforts.
Before coming to Canal Alliance, Jamie worked at Marin Food Bank where she was a volunteer coordinator and administrative assistant. Currently, she lives in Novato where she also volunteers as an ESL teacher at Jumpstart Network, Inc. Jamie also participated in the English Opens Doors Program as an EFL teacher in Chile and interned as an ESL teacher at the American Language and Culture Institute in Chico. She enjoys teaching, traveling, helping underprivileged people and researching issues related to second/foreign language acquisition.
Jamie completed her M.A. in Teaching International Languages with a graduate certificate in Teaching English to Speakers of Other Languages (TESOL) at California State University, Chico.
Her Bachelor’s degrees are in Pre-Credential Spanish and Latin American Studies with Minors in Linguistics and Japanese. She has taught English and Japanese to elementary, high school and university students around the globe.
